WebMar 28, 2024 · An oligopoly is a type of market structure where two or more firms have significant market power. Collectively, they have the ability to dictate prices and supply. Generally, a market is considered an oligopoly when 50 percent of the market is controlled by the leading 4 firms. An oligopoly can be identified using either the concentration ratio ... WebJul 5, 2024 · In an oligopoly, the firms are the players and their payoffs are their profits. Each player must choose a strategy, which is a plan describing how a player moves or acts in different situations. A strategy is a game plan describing how a player acts, or moves, in each possible situation. Although only a … chitsike by freemanWebOligopoly refers to a market situation in which there are a few firms selling homogeneous or differentiated products. Oligopoly is, sometimes, also known as ‘competition among the few’ as there are few sellers in the market and every seller influences and is influenced by the behaviour of other firms.
